Optional PCI Fan Assembly

The optional PCI fan module provides cooling for the expansion cards.

NOTICE: Your system requires the PCI fan assembly if your system has a SAS controller that can be connected to an external storage system. Removing the fan assembly or disabling the fan could result in your system overheating and shutting down unexpectedly.

Removing the PCI Fan Assembly

CAUTION: Only trained service technicians are authorized to remove the system cover and access any of the components inside the system. Before performing any procedure, see your Product Information Guide for complete information about safety precautions, working inside the computer and protecting against electrostatic discharge.

1Open the system. See "Opening the System" on page 54.

2Disconnect the following cables from the system board and SAS controller (if present):

fan power cable

intrusion switch cable

hard drive interface cables

control panel interface cable

optical drive interface cable (if present)

3Pull the interface cables through the panel cutout and fold them out of the way. See Figure 3-12.

4Using a #2 Phillips screwdriver, remove the two screws securing the PCI fan assembly to the chassis. See Figure 3-12.

5Remove the fan assembly from the system.
